Variables to Consider



When picking the right wood for custom-made cabinets, there are a number of essential aspects to think about.

The first aspect is sturdiness. You desire a timber kind that can withstand daily usage and resist scratches, damages, and various other types of wear and tear. Oak and maple are popular options known for their sturdiness.

Second of all, consider the visual allure of the timber. Various timbers offer distinct grain patterns and colors that can substantially affect the overall appearance of your cupboards. Cherry timber, for instance, has a rich, reddish-brown hue that includes warmth to any area.

Another critical element is the expense of the timber. Some woods are extra costly than others, so it's vital to discover a balance between your spending plan and the quality you prefer.

Finally, think of the upkeep needs of the wood. Some timbers might require normal sealing or brightening to keep their look, while others are more low-maintenance. By carefully taking into consideration these elements, you can choose the perfect timber for your personalized cabinets that straightens with your preferences and demands.

Popular Timber Options



For popular wood options when thinking about custom cupboards, it's vital to discover a selection of selections that align with your preferences and practical requirements.

Oak is an ageless fave as a result of its durability and traditional appearance.

Maple offers a smooth and regular grain pattern, excellent for contemporary aesthetic appeals.

Cherry wood flaunts an abundant, reddish hue that deepens with time, adding heat to any room.



Walnut is a luxurious option with a dark, abundant color and one-of-a-kind grain patterns.

If you like an even more rustic look, think about hickory for its unique grain variations and toughness.

For a smooth and modern feeling, ash is a popular choice because of its light shade and straight grain.

Mahogany is a costs option recognized for its deep, reddish-brown shade and fine grain.

These popular timber options give a variety of choices to suit different styles and preferences for your custom-made cabinets.

Budget-Friendly Alternatives



To discover more affordable options for custom cupboards, you can take into consideration timber alternatives that use both cost and quality.

One great choice is want, known for its light color and straight grain. Pine is widely offered and cheaper than woods like oak or maple. While it may be softer than various other timbers, it can still be a long lasting option when correctly secured and preserved.

One more affordable choice is birch, which has a penalty, consistent texture and a pale color that can be quickly tarnished to simulate more expensive woods like cherry. Birch is more powerful than want and provides good value for those on a tighter spending plan.

In addition, engineered timber items, such as MDF (medium-density fiber board) or plywood, can be affordable choices. These products are stable, immune to bending, and can be veneered with a slim layer of hardwood to give the appearance of strong wood cupboards without the high price.
